Jack Kosslyn
Born 1920 · New London, Connecticut, USA
Jack Kosslyn was a drama coach in the Los Angeles area for over forty years and taught classes at his own studio in Hollywood. He also worked for Universal Studios and Warner Brothers, and coached performers including David Janssen, Mary Tyler Moore and John Travolta. He spent six years with Clint Eastwood's Malpaso Productions as a casting director, dialogue coach, and actor, appearing in small parts in several of Eastwood's films. In the 1980s, he helped form OPACT, the Organization of Professional Acting Coaches and Teachers.
